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Beautiful Yellow Underwing | Black Lion Tamarin |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(حيوانات) | Animalia (حيوانات)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(مفصليات الأرجل) | Chordata (حبليات) |
| Class | Insecta (حشرات) | Mammalia (ثدييات) |
| Order | Lepidoptera (حرشفيات الأجنحة) | Primates (رئيسيات) |
| Family | Noctuidae | Callitrichidae |
| Genus | Anarta | Leontopithecus |
| Species | Anarta myrtilli | Leontopithecus chrysopygus |
